Representation Summary:

Current services (e.g. schools and healthcare) are not sufficient to support the number of residents in Thornton & Allerton, yet this plan will see an additional 1,200 dwellings built with no consideration given to improving infrastructure without having to use yet more Green Belt land.

While many of Allerton's sites are planned on Brownfield sites, the majority of the 700 dwellings planned are flats or apartments.

Allerton is predominately a family area and there is no demand for flats within the ward. Many of these families want to move into homes with a garden and space. Again the local plan is not sympathetic to the needs of the residents, nor is the real lack of social housing being offered in this area. Much of the social housing within Allerton falls just within the limits of liveable - residents should live in a home that is fit for their needs. Not simply adequate by council standards.
